Mailpile - Mailpile is a modern, fast web-mail client with user-friendly encryption and privacy features.
Postfix - Postfix is a mail transfer agent (MTA) that routes and delivers electronic mail.
Horde - Horde Groupware is a free, enterprise ready, browser based collaboration suite.
Exim - Exim is a message transfer agent (MTA) developed at the University of Cambridge for use on Unix systems connected to the Internet.
Roundcube - Web-based IMAP email client
sSMTP - sSMTP is a simple MTA to deliver mail from a computer to a mail server.
